Tournament Format
The AIA Memphis Golf Tournament is a 4-person scramble, with teams of four players competing against one another.
Eligibility and Pairing
The AIA Memphis Golf Tournament is open to the public! AIA members and corporate partners, nonmembers, guests, design professionals, engineers, contractors, product representatives, and community leaders are welcome to participate. The tournament is filled on a first-come, first-serve basis, and is limited to 144 participants.

Dress Code and Shoe Policy
Shirts and shoes must be worn on the golf course at all times. Men's shirts should have sleeves. Bathing attire, cut off shorts, halter-tops, tube-tops, tank-tops, and similar types of recreational wear are not considered proper dress on the golf course. Shoe Policy: Soft Spikes Only facility. Shoes worn on the golf course must be appropriate for golf, as determined by the General Manager, the shop staff, or the TurfGrass Manager.
